Physical properties
Violet to blue-purple, translucent, vitreous-to-waxy luster, and commonly showing cubic cleavage; Mohs hardness 4, specific gravity about 3.18. The rounded edges and glossy surface indicate human polishing or tumbling.
Formation & geological history
Forms mainly in hydrothermal veins and replacement deposits, often with quartz, calcite, galena, or barite; deposits range from Paleozoic to younger Cenozoic ages. The image alone cannot establish locality or exact identification.
Uses & applications
Used as a flux in steel and aluminum production, in hydrofluoric-acid manufacture, and as ornamental or collectible material; fine transparent pieces may be cut as gemstones but are relatively soft.
Geological facts
Purple color commonly results from radiation-related color centers or trace elements. Fluorite’s excellent cleavage makes it prone to chipping, and its cubic crystals are a key diagnostic feature.
Field identification & locations
Look for cubic cleavage, moderate weight, softness, and a glassy purple appearance; a steel knife may scratch it, while quartz should not. Common sources include China, Mexico, England, Spain, Illinois, and Colorado.
